House Resolution 1668 serves to congratulate Carlos Arispe for his recognition during the 2022 From the Delta, With Love ceremony organized by the City of Edcouch. This resolution honors Arispe's artistic contributions and celebrates the vibrant culture of the Delta area. The bill emphasizes the importance of acknowledging individuals who enrich their communities through artistic endeavors, showcasing the value placed on local talent and cultural contributions within the legislative framework.
